Q: Is 92,893,597 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 92,893,597 is a composite number.

Why is 92,893,597 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 92,893,597 can be evenly divided by 1 5,657 16,421 and 92,893,597, with no remainder.

Since 92,893,597 cannot be divided by just 1 and 92,893,597, it is a composite number.
